AUTHOR BIO

Elizabeth Price is a word artist and media scholar that would like to be known for her words of encouragement and self-confidence, asking her readers to love their differences. She is currently pursuing a Masters in Communication Management degree candidate at the University of Southern California’ s Annenberg School for Communication and Journalism, where she studies digital marketing, brand management, Hollywood culture production, and other subjects relating to how we communicate ideas, images, products and identities in the 21st century. She graduated from USC with a BA in Communication and a minor in Music Industry in 2012.
The Oakland-raised author loves many things, some of which include Golden Era Hip Hop, fitness and wellness, jazz chords, alliteration, the thrill of finding the perfect pair of shoes at a vintage hole in the wall, books on astrology, and Trader Joe’ s seaweed chips.
